Concrete foundation repair services involve assessing and fixing issues with the structural base that supports a building. Over time, foundations can develop cracks, settling, or shifting due to soil movement, moisture changes, or other environmental factors. Repair work typically includes methods such as underpinning, piering, or slab stabilization to restore stability and prevent further damage. These services are essential for maintaining the integrity of a property and ensuring it remains safe and secure for occupants.
Many common problems indicate a need for foundation repair. These include visible cracks in walls or floors, doors and windows that no longer close properly, uneven flooring, or noticeable settling of the structure. Such issues often point to underlying shifts or weaknesses in the foundation. Addressing these problems promptly with the help of experienced local contractors can prevent more extensive damage, reduce costly repairs later, and help preserve the property's value.
Foundation repair services are applicable to a variety of property types, including single-family homes, multi-unit residential buildings, and small commercial structures. Homes built on expansive or unstable soils are particularly susceptible to foundation issues. Properties in areas with significant moisture fluctuations or poor drainage may also experience foundation problems over time. In these cases, professional repair services can reinforce the foundation, stabilize the structure, and extend the lifespan of the property.

What are common signs of foundation problems? Signs include visible cracks in walls or floors, uneven or sloping surfaces, doors or windows that stick or don’t close properly, and gaps around window frames or doorways.
How do contractors typically assess foundation damage? They perform visual inspections, evaluate existing cracks or shifts, and may use specialized tools to measure movement or stability of the foundation.
What repair methods are used for concrete foundation issues? Repair options include underpinning, slabjacking, wall stabilization, and crack injection, depending on the severity and type of damage.
What factors can lead to foundation damage in Kingston, WA? Factors include soil movement, moisture fluctuations, poor drainage, and nearby excavation or construction activities that affect soil stability.
How can property owners prevent future foundation problems? Proper drainage, maintaining consistent moisture levels around the foundation, and addressing minor cracks early can help prevent more serious issues over time.
